What Does It Indicate to implement a Bank card to help make ACH Payments?
Customarily, ACH payments are funded straight from a bank account. Nowadays, numerous payment platforms enable you to fund ACH payments employing a bank card. In this method, your credit card is billed, and also the System sends the payment to your recipient in the ACH network.
Into the receiver, the payment seems as a typical ACH deposit, even though the payer used a bank card.

Charges and Fees to contemplate

While ACH payments are usually low-cost or free, using a credit card to fund ACH payments often involves a processing fee. These fees typically range from 2% to 4% of your transaction total.
Firms need to Evaluate service fees with the worth of money flow Rewards and charge card rewards.
